摘要
对深基坑工程中计算柔性挡土结构的弹性支点法作了改进 ,提出了考虑柔性挡土结构与土之间摩擦效应的分析方法。计算结果表明考虑摩擦效应时柔性挡土结构的内力及变形都有较显著的减小。
The finite element method of beam on elastic subgrade is modified to study the contact frictional effect between retaining wall and soil. The element stiffness matrix that can consider the contact frictional effect is derived by the virtual displacement principle method. The computed result shows that when the contact frictional effect is considered, the displacement and the stress of retaining wall will be reduced considerably.
